Transaction 758063f453a139c8ab039055df698e5b6e6fd2ff1fe246de8a8ba6027eafbd73
1 Input
1 Output
-
758063f453a139c8ab039055df698e5b6e6fd2ff1fe246de8a8ba6027eafbd73:0
- value
- 380000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c83dde13bfcab779d2f650c29f380537fbccc94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 154NhheGcWjEUxRE1CcXLmzoa1sPGb84FN